393 High Street, Glencliff, NH 03238 · 6039893111 · 130 certified beds
CMS lists no chain affiliation for this facility. Ownership type on record: Government - State.
Total nurse staffing: 4.23 (New Hampshire median: 3.65). RN hours: 0.90. Weekend total: 3.72. Nursing staff turnover: 14%.
All-time on record: 11 deficiency citations. Below: citations from 2023 onward (severity letters explained in methodology).
